JOB TITLE: FOOD & SAFETY OFFICER

About This Job:

Q-Sourcing Limited trading as Q-Sourcing Servtec is a manpower management solutions firm operating in the East African Region in the countries of Uganda, Kenya, Tanzania, Rwanda, and South Sudan.

Job Role Description

Reporting directly to the Country Director or CEO. The Food Safety Officers will work in conjunction with the Production Director and Group Executive Chef, Logistics, and other departments to ensure food safety while ingredients and products are in the organization’s control.

The Food Safety Officer’s mission will be to put in place and actively maintain the

organization’s systems and documentation to ensure food safety, to sensitize and train

staff on food safety standards and regulations, to lead food safety meetings.

Roles and responsibilities

  1. Develop and keep up to date all necessary documentation with regards to food safety, the HACCP system, and other food safety standards (ISO 22000, Halal certification, BRC, IFS)
  2. Review all Critical Control Point (CCP) monitoring and verification records to ensure compliance with HACCP critical limits and frequencies, as required by the HACCP plan.
  3. Monitor HACCP and PRPs to ensure procedures are properly carried out.
  4. Review and evaluate all records for accuracy and completeness and determine the need for process improvement.
  5. Develop and implement training plans for HACCP and all food safety standards of the company
  6. Ensure identification, labeling, and traceability system functions as planned.
  7. Conduct Food Safety team meetings and required HACCP review.
  8. Analyze processes, identify trends and anomalies, and continuously evaluate plant programs for improvement.
  9. Ensure all food safety-related documents and records are controlled.
  10. Stay abreast of food safety laws and regulations.

Qualifications and Skills required.

  1. A bachelor’s or master’s degree in food science, biology, nutrition, or a related field is a must, as well as a minimum of 8 years of experience in food operations/food safety.
  2. Successfully helped other organizations obtain Haccp and FSC22000 and halal certifications
  3. Must be able to demonstrate the ability to develop and deliver food safety training and workshops.
  4. Excellent oral and written communication skills and the ability to work well with people at all levels are essential.
  5. Must be able to evaluate information quickly, identify key issues, and formulate conclusions based on sound, practical judgment, and experience.
  6. Must be able to work effectively in a dynamic and complex environment.
  7. Must be proficient in Microsoft Office (Word and Excel specifically)
  8. Impeccable personal hygiene is a must.
